Home
last modified time | relevance | path

Searched refs:i915_vm_to_ggtt (Results 1 - 17 of 17) sorted by relevance

/kernel/linux/linux-6.6/drivers/gpu/drm/i915/
H A Di915_gem_evict.c48 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in ggtt_flush()
188 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in i915_gem_evict_something()
353 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in i915_gem_evict_for_node()
H A Di915_vma.h185 return i915_vm_to_ggtt(vma->vm)->pin_bias; in i915_ggtt_pin_bias()
H A Di915_vma.c573 ptr = io_mapping_map_wc(&i915_vm_to_ggtt(vma->vm)->iomap, in i915_vma_pin_iomap()
700 i915_vm_to_ggtt(vma->vm)->mappable_end; in __i915_vma_set_map_and_fenceable()
796 end = min_t(u64, end, i915_vm_to_ggtt(vma->vm)->mappable_end); in i915_vma_insert()
1589 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in __i915_ggtt_pin()
/kernel/linux/linux-5.10/drivers/gpu/drm/i915/gt/
H A Dintel_ggtt.c197 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en8_ggtt_insert_page()
212 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en8_ggtt_insert_entries()
248 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en6_ggtt_insert_page()
268 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en6_ggtt_insert_entries()
301 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en8_ggtt_clear_range()
389 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en6_ggtt_clear_range()
605 ppgtt_bind_vma(&i915_vm_to_ggtt(vm)->alias->vm, in aliasing_gtt_bind_vma()
619 ppgtt_unbind_vma(&i915_vm_to_ggtt(vm)->alias->vm, vma); in aliasing_gtt_unbind_vma()
841 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en6_gmch_remove()
H A Dgen6_ppgtt.c307 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in pd_vma_bind()
H A Dintel_gtt.h368 i915_vm_to_ggtt(struct i915_address_space *vm) in i915_vm_to_ggtt() function
H A Dintel_ggtt_fencing.c356 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vma->vm); in __i915_vma_pin_fence()
H A Dintel_ring_submission.c201 vm = &i915_vm_to_ggtt(vm)->alias->vm; in vm_alias()
H A Dintel_lrc.c5280 return i915_vm_to_ggtt(vm)->alias; in vm_alias()
/kernel/linux/linux-6.6/drivers/gpu/drm/i915/gt/
H A Dintel_ggtt.c285 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en8_ggtt_insert_page()
299 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en8_ggtt_insert_entries()
336 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en8_ggtt_clear_range()
360 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en6_ggtt_insert_page()
380 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en6_ggtt_insert_entries()
485 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en6_ggtt_clear_range()
694 ppgtt_bind_vma(&i915_vm_to_ggtt(vm)->alias->vm, in aliasing_gtt_bind_vma()
710 ppgtt_unbind_vma(&i915_vm_to_ggtt(vm)->alias->vm, vma_res); in aliasing_gtt_unbind_vma()
958 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in gen6_gmch_remove()
H A Dgen6_ppgtt.c286 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vm); in pd_vma_bind()
H A Dintel_gtt.h454 i915_vm_to_ggtt(struct i915_address_space *vm) in i915_vm_to_ggtt() function
H A Dintel_ggtt_fencing.c363 struct i915_ggtt *ggtt = i915_vm_to_ggtt(vma->vm); in __i915_vma_pin_fence()
H A Dintel_ring_submission.c148 vm = &i915_vm_to_ggtt(vm)->alias->vm; in vm_alias()
H A Dintel_lrc.c912 return i915_vm_to_ggtt(vm)->alias; in vm_alias()
/kernel/linux/linux-5.10/drivers/gpu/drm/i915/
H A Di915_vma.h124 return i915_vm_to_ggtt(vma->vm)->pin_bias; in i915_ggtt_pin_bias()
H A Di915_vma.c464 ptr = io_mapping_map_wc(&i915_vm_to_ggtt(vma->vm)->iomap, in i915_vma_pin_iomap()
571 mappable = vma->node.start + vma->fence_size <= i915_vm_to_ggtt(vma->vm)->mappable_end; in __i915_vma_set_map_and_fenceable()
652 end = min_t(u64, end, i915_vm_to_ggtt(vma->vm)->mappable_end); in i915_vma_insert()

Completed in 28 milliseconds